My husband always had high blood pressure.....we eat alot cleaner now and I've almost completely cut deli meat from our diet. A big concern was the sodium nitrates.....his diet consisted of deli lunch meats for lunch practially everyday for years. Now he really does not eat meat for lunches. peanut butter and honey on whole grain bread (he eats this most days, and says it's satisfying and he's not bored of it). Or I'll make a low sodium soup and send a slice of whole grain bread (so he can heat it up) or once in awhile I'll make a turkey breast or chicken for some sandwiches (they don't last long because no preservatives). His blood pressure is the best it has ever been.
Basically cooking food yourself is the best way for lower sodium.....but it takes time and commitment, but the payoff is worth it.

Hi Bob, I love eggs as well. I'm rather picky of my egg whites (I only like a product called "ALL Whites" made by Crystal Farms.....they don't add any coloring and they taste great).
In the beginning add one real egg to a few servings of the egg whites to get you use to it. (but thats if you eat them plain.....if you put add ins you will never tell)
However I've made them for my brother/his gf and other family members and they don't know the difference that they are eating only egg whites. I'm a girl that likes STUFF in my eggs......so I load it up with anything I can think of.
I saute up some onions, garlic, and peppers then put them off to side. I sometimes will saute up a few mushrooms seperate (put them off to side). Then I will cook up several servings of "All Whites" 1/4 cup is 30 cal. and 6g protein....so I'll make 4 or 5 servings. When eggs are almost done add in the sauted veggies for a minute. Plate it up and add some salsa.
Sometimes I will stir in a cup of brown rice (cooked first) to that mixture and then put it in a wrap or eat it as is.
I also like to make the egg mixture I wrote about about (sauted onions, garlic, ect) and add in some baby spinach as last minute of cooking. Then put the mixture on a flax pita, a couple tbsp. of pizza sauce, a couple tbsp. of low fat mozz. and bake in over for 5-10 minutes........great breakfast pizza *and so filling*.
Stuff I added to them was cup of cooked broccoli, sauted leeks, carrots, anything you can think of.
Hope I gave you a few ideas......I think if you enjoy eggs you will like them.
